Dutch regulator fines Clearview AI $33.6 million for GDPR violations

The Dutch Data Protection Authority (DPA) has fined troubled facial recognition company Clearview AI 30.5 million euros ($33.6 million US) for violating Europe’s General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R). The DPA says that Clearview’s database, containing over 40 billion images, is illegal under European law.Read Entire Article…

The Dutch are having none of Clearview AI harvesting your photos

GDPR fines keep amassing for Clearview AI — a US-based startup known for its thorough (and potentially perilous) facial recognition services. Following similar measures by data protection authorities in France, Italy, and Greece, the Netherlands’ DPA today hit Clearview with a €30.5mn fine for its “illegal” database of photos…
